This one is at $71.09 and there are still five hours to go!  It's a variant, with two different cells (Boggart changing shape in Lupin's class and Buckbeak rearing up to slash Draco) in the Harry and owl in the courtyard card.

The cards with two different cells usually sell for more, but I've never seen one go this high.  You might want to put a reserve on yours, Bryan.  I bought one like this a couple of months ago for $13.62 (Lupin classroom card with cells of Stan Shunpike on the Knight Bus and Sirius' prison cell at Hogwarts).

There just tend to be phases when certain types of variant etc are it. Like 3 months or so after PoAU came out Fizzing Whizbees were IT and they went for between £150 and £250.
